Save a Life
Certifications by NHCPS has just released its newest course: CPR, AED, and
First Aid. This manual is based on the 2020-2025 CPR, AED, and First Aid
guidelines published by the International Liaison Committee on Resuscitation
(ILCOR) and is designed to train people everywhere to respond to everyday
emergencies. The course covers first aid basics, including first aid kits,
tooth injuries, bee stings, insect bites, nose bleeds, and other common
problems.
Advanced topics include heart attack, stroke, asthma emergencies, head
injuries, burns, and more. Each topic is broken down into critical decisions to
make and steps to take. This book will give you the confidence you need in
situations that range from minor to crisis. The book also covers how to provide
adult, child, and infant CPR, as well as the use of automated external
defibrillators (AEDs). This course is written by Dr. Karl F. Disque, a
board-certified anesthesiologist, and a registered pharmacist. Dr. Disque has
certified thousands of healthcare professionals with his courses in Advanced
Cardiac Life Support (ACLS), Pediatric Advanced Life Support (PALS), and Basic
Life Support (BLS), and now he brings that same expertise to his first course
designed for people in the community. This is one of the most effective and
user-friendly training manuals on the market because it was created by a team
dedicated to life support education with the goal of training people to help
save lives.
